Catalyst Bancorp Inc

F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- REGIONAL · USA

Catalyst Bancorp, Inc. is focused on operating as a holding company of the St Landry Homestead Federal Savings Bank providing various banking services to individual and corporate clients in Louisiana. The company is headquartered in Opelousas, Louisiana.

Hartford Financial Services Group

FINANCIAL SERVICES · INSURANCE - DIVERSIFIED · USA

The Hartford Financial Services Group, Inc., usually known as The Hartford, is a United States-based investment and insurance company.
